well-groomed
well–groomed
adj \-ˈgrümd, -ˈgru̇md\Definition of WELL-GROOMED
1
: well-dressed and scrupulously neat <well–groomed men>
2
: made neat, tidy, and attractive down to the smallest details <a well–groomed lawn>
First Known Use of WELL-GROOMED
1840
Related to WELL-GROOMED
Synonyms: antiseptic, bandbox, crisp, groomed, kempt, orderly, picked up, prim, shipshape, smug, snug, tidied, tidy, trig, trim, uncluttered, well-groomed
Antonyms: disheveled (or dishevelled), disordered, disorderly, messy, mussed, mussy, sloven, slovenly, unkempt, untidy
Related Words: dapper, natty, saucy, smart, spiffy, spruce; immaculate, spick-and-span (or spic-and-span), spotless; rakish, sleek, streamlined, taut; organized, straight, systematic
